31,508,766 (thirty-one million five hundred eight thousand seven hundred sixty-six) is an even 8-digit number. It is a composite number with 24 divisors, and factors as 2 × 3² × 43 × 40,709. Its proper divisors sum to 38,349,594,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E0C91E.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 31508766, here are decompositions:

  • 19 + 31508747 = 31508766
  • 53 + 31508713 = 31508766
  • 83 + 31508683 = 31508766
  • 89 + 31508677 = 31508766
  • 109 + 31508657 = 31508766
  • 127 + 31508639 = 31508766
  • 197 + 31508569 = 31508766
  • 199 + 31508567 = 31508766

Showing the first eight; more decompositions exist.
